1. A fully integrated 2.4-GHz LC-VCO frequency synthesizer with 3-ps jitter in 0.18-μm standard digital CMOS copper technology
Da Dalt, N.; Derksen, S.; Greco, P.; Sandner, C.; Schmid, H.; Strohmayer, K.;
Solid-State Circuits, IEEE Journal of
Volume 37,  Issue 7,  July 2002 Page(s):959 - 962
Abstract:

In this paper, we present a fully integrated frequency synthesizer, using an LC voltage-controlled oscillator (LC-VCO) as the core oscillator. The synthesizer is designed to provide various output clock signals for a transceiver chip. Sampling clocks for on-chip analog-to-digital and digital-to-analog conversion modules are also generated, where low jitter is required. The synthesizer also includes an additional digital phase-locked loop and programmable fractional dividers. We present the general concept, special issues related to low jitter, and test chip results. The synthesizer achieves 3-ps rms long-term jitter on a 200-MHz output with 20-mW power and an area of 0.7 mm2
